## Releases

Quick note for new folks: Fanlane is our notification fan-out service, and the whole point of the last two releases has been backpressure. When the Pigeonhole queue backs up past the high-water mark, workers shed low-priority pushes and drain digests first—don't "fix" that, it's deliberate. Releases go out weekly from the main branch after the load-shed test suite passes. Every release tarball gets signed before it hits the internal mirror, and the verifier refuses anything unsigned. We sign with the key below.

deploy key for kahof-tadup: bky4_rRMZ

Subject: Gross-margin review, Q3

Quick summary ahead of the planning session: blended gross margin slipped to 41%, mostly down to input costs on the Fennick range and some aggressive discounting in the Westvale region. The Torbridge plant upgrade should claw back two points by Q1. We're also tightening the discount approval ladder — nothing above 12% without sign-off from Orla's team. Services margin remains healthy and is carrying the quarter. The confidential note appended below sets out what this means for next year's plan.

board note of kagep-yahig: Only 9 of the 120 pilot accounts renewed Quenix, so a churn review is set for April 1.

TICKET-4471: AssignMint staging misconfig

The experiment assignment service in staging was pointed at the production bucketing salt. Flagging for security review. Rotated the salt, scoped IAM roles, and scrubbed old env snapshots. Remaining step: the staging env file needs its own signing secret so assignments can't be replayed across environments. For the reviewer's reference, the corrected env line follows immediately below this sentence.

vault entry, kafog-yahop: COURIER_KEY8=0faa53ae

The FeeForge rules engine, which computes shipping fees for Marlowe Mercantile checkouts, is intermittently failing to reach its rules database since the 14:20 deploy. Symptoms: pool acquisition timeouts every few minutes, fee evaluation falling back to cached rules. Restarting the service clears it for roughly an hour. Suspect a leaked connection in the new tier-lookup path. On-call: please enable pool tracing and capture a leak report. Use the staging database via the connection string below.

replica DSN, kagaf-kajef: postgresql://eliius_svc:UA@db-a408.paliqnet.internal:5432/istys